1702 - Maximum Binary String After Change.Medium
You are given a binary string
binary
consisting of only0
’s or1
’s. You can apply each of the following operations any number of times:- Operation 1: If the number contains the substring
"00"
, you can replace it with"10"
.- For example,
"00010" -> "10010
"
- For example,
- Operation 2: If the number contains the substring
"10"
, you can replace it with"01"
.- For example,
"00010" -> "00001"
- For example,
Return the maximum binary string you can obtain after any number of operations. Binary string
x
is greater than binary stringy
ifx
’s decimal representation is greater thany
’s decimal representation.Example 1:
Input: binary = “000110”
Output: “111011”
Explanation: A valid transformation sequence can be:
“000110” -> “000101”
“000101” -> “100101”
“100101” -> “110101”
“110101” -> “110011”
“110011” -> “111011”
Example 2:
Input: binary = “01”
Output: “01”
Explanation: “01” cannot be transformed any further.
Constraints:
1 <= binary.length <= 105
